There are 420 calories in a Ham, Egg, & Cheese Biscuit from Burger King. Most of those calories come from fat (51%) and carbohydrates (33%).
To burn the 420 calories in a Ham, Egg, & Cheese Biscuit, you would have to run for 37 minutes or walk for 60 minutes.
Serving Size | 164g | |
Calories | 420 | |
Calories From Fat | 200 | |
Amount Per Serving | % Daily Value* | |
Total Fat | 22g | 34% |
Saturated Fat | 15.0g | 75% |
Trans Fat | 1.0g | |
Cholesterol | 185mg | 62% |
Sodium | 1410mg | 59% |
Total Carbohydrates | 33g | 11% |
Dietary Fiber | 1g | 4% |
Sugars | 5g | |
Protein | 16g | 32% |
